5. A liquid flows through an orifice located in the side of a tank as shown in the Figure below. A commonly used equation for detemining the volume rate of flow, Q, through the orifice is Q = 0.61A/2gh where A is the area of the orifice, g is the acceleration of gravity, and h is the height of the liquid above the orifice.
